We are seeking a purpose-driven team member dedicated to providing quality care to patients in a safe and professional environment. The Patient Care Technician Trainee (PCT Trainee) will be in training to learn how to provide direct patient care under the supervision of the Registered Nurse. The PCT Trainee will learn how to perform the hemodialysis treatment according to Satellite and the local center's policies and procedures. The care that will be taught will include taking and monitoring patient vital signs, performing blood tests, documenting appropriate patient information, preparing and monitoring dialysis equipment, and cleaning equipment.You will play a vital role to ensure that we deliver on our Mission to make life better for those with kidney disease and our Vision to be unsurpassed in our individualized experience, our quality, and our compassion.
